1959: LSU 7, Clemson 0
The 1959 Sugar Bowl featured top-ranked LSU Tigers and Clemson. LSU had already secured the national title, as the final editions of both major polls were released a month earlier in early December. The game’s only score came in the late in third quarter, when Heisman winner Billy Cannon threw a 9-yard touchdown pass to Mickey Mangham. Cannon was named Sugar Bowl MVP.
